Starbucks offers free coffee the Monday after the Super Bowl: How to get yours
Super Bowl 59 is this Sunday, meaning millions of viewers across the country will stay up late to watch the game, whether for the football, for the halftime show, or for the commercials. Starbucks is hoping to wake fans up Monday with free coffee.
The coffee chain announced Wednesday it is offering Starbucks Rewards members free coffee on Monday, Feb. 10, in a promotion the company is calling "Starbucks Monday." If you are a member of the rewards program, you can stop in for a free tall hot or iced brewed coffee any time, the company said.
Customers can apply the Starbucks Monday coupon in the Starbucks app prior to placing your order when using the order ahead feature on the app, or tell your barista you are redeeming the coupon when ordering in-store or in the drive-thru.
If you are not a Starbucks Rewards member, you can sign up by 11:59 p.m. Pacific Time on Feb. 9 to get your Starbucks Monday coupon in the app, the company said. If you join the Starbucks Rewards program on Feb. 10, the company says you can see your barista in the store to enjoy a free coffee.
"No matter who wins Sunday, we can all win Monday," Starbucks said.
Starbucks' Valentine's Day drinks have arrived
Valentine's Day is also right around the corner and Starbucks is celebrating with two new limited-time beverages.
The coffee chain announced Monday the drinks would be available beginning Feb. 4 a limited time while supplies last.
The drinks include:
Chocolate-Covered Strawberry Créme Frappuccino: A blend of strawberry puree, Frappuccino chips, milk and ice, which is then layered on top of a splash of strawberry puree and finished with whipped cream and mocha drizzle.
Chocolate Hazelnut Cookie Cold Brew: Made with Starbucks Cold Brew, sweetened with vanilla syrup and topped with chocolatey hazelnut flavored cream cold foam and chocolate cookie crumbles.
